乳牛乳房炎无乳链球菌内蒙古分离株SIP基因克隆与序列分析
loning and Sequencing of SIP Gene of isolated Strain from Inner Mongolia for Diary Mastitis Streptoccocus Agalactiae
根据Genbank 公布的牛源无乳链球菌SIP基因序列,设计并合成一对引物,通过PCR 扩增,获得SIP基因部分扩增产物。序列分析结果表明,SIP基因扩增产物大小为945bp, 负责编码315个氨基酸残基。标准菌株(+株)与内蒙古分离株(M株)的基因及氨基酸同源性100%,该两个菌株与Genbank上公布的B群无乳链球菌菌株(DQ914274)SIP基因及氨基酸同源性达到98.94%及99.68%。高度同源性结果为进一步研究和开发新型有效免疫制剂及诊断试剂奠定了理论和实验依据。
pair of primers were designed and synthesized according to SIP gene sequences of bovine mastitis Streptococcus agalactiae published on Genbank. SIP gene fragment were amplified by PCR。Sequencing result showed that SIP gene was 945bp in length, which were encoding 315 amino acid residues. The standard strain (+strain) and isolated strain from Inner Mongolia (M strain) had 100% of homology in genes and amino acid. The SIP Gene and amino acid sequence of the two strains and published Streptococcus agalactiae group B strain (DQ914274) on genbank were homology reach 98.94% and 99.68%, respectively. The result of a high degree of homology has laid a theoretical and experimental basis for further research and development of new effective immune agents and diagnostic reagents.
